Going away with friends can be a great opportunity to catch up and create lasting memories. There are many different adventures that you can look into from city breaks to murder mystery dinners. This post suggests 7 ideas that could make for a unique and enjoyable bonding experience, whether you’re planning to get away with a group of mates or just your BFF. 

City break

Exploring a new city with a friend could be a chance to combine pure travel and hanging out time. You could plan a staycation in an exciting UK city like London, Brighton, York or Edinburgh. Or you could look further afield and visit a city on the continent like Amsterdam, Budapest or Barcelona. These trips can be squeezed onto a weekend and you can split accommodation costs. It’s up to you whether you spend it sightseeing, shopping or going on an epic bar crawl. 

Golf getaway

Visiting a golf course for the day and staying the night could be a great lads escape, but equally a great girls getaway if you like the outdoors and sports. Look for golf courses with luxury hotels on site. After a day spent on the golf course, you can enjoy drinks and food at the hotel.

Hiking expedition

Those craving a rugged rural adventure could consider a hiking expedition. You could explore the Lake District together, plan a long coastal walk or even climb a mountain like Snowdon. This could be combined with a camping trip, or a cosy stay in a local B&B.

Spa retreat

If you’re been under a lot of stress and your friend is feeling equally frazzled, a spa retreat could be a great way to spend your time together. This could be a single night’s stay at a local spa hotel or a multi-day retreat at a yoga camp in the sun. Such holidays make for great girls’ trips, but there’s nothing to stop guys planning a spa retreat either.

Wine tour

There are many wineries (including a handful in the UK) that provide tours and tastings along with overnight stays. This could be a chance to try wines and catch up. Surf camp

Never tried surfing before, but eager to give it a go? Surf camps are popular holiday options for thrillseeker friends. You can spend each day learning to surf and each evening eating out and drinking in local bars. You’ll find surf schools around the UK coast and abroad in sunnier locations like Portugal and the Canary Islands. 

Murder mystery dinner

For a single overnight break you won’t forget, why not try a murder mystery dinner? This typically involves an interactive dinner with actors where you solve clues to try to find the murderer. Some of these murder mystery dinners take place in hotels, providing you with somewhere to stay for the night. You’ll find them all across the UK.
